The TXD2-3V relay is High Breakdown Voltage Relay with high sensitivity, reliability, and robust construction. Let’s learning the key features, typical applications, packing style, and selection criteria for the TXD2-3V Panasonic relay.
For high-performance applications,suitable for industrial, automotive, telecommunications, and consumer electronics.
1. Complies with EN60950 Supplementary Insulation Standards
Meet the EN60950 safety standard, ensuring sufficient insulation between the coil and contacts. This compliance is crucial for preventing electrical hazards in high-voltage applications.
• Clearances: 2.0 mm .079 inch or more
• Creepage distance: 2.5 mm .098 inch or more
2. High Breakdown Voltage (3,000 V Between Contact and Coil)
With a 3,000 V breakdown voltage between contact and coil. The body block construction of the coil that is sealed formation.
3. High Sensitivity (200 mW Nominal Operating Power)
Use highly efficient polar magnetic circuit “seesaw balance mechanism”. Achieve a nominal operating power of 200 mW.
4. High Contact Capacity (2 A, 30 V DC)
5. Gold-Clad Crossbar Twin Contacts for Superior Reliability
The relay features gold-clad crossbar twin contacts, ensuring low contact resistance, minimal arcing, and long-term reliability. Additionally, gas-expelling materials during manufacturing enhance durability by preventing oxidation.
6. Exceptional Vibration and Shock Resistance
Functional shock resistance: 750 m/s
Destructive shock resistance: 1,000 m/s
Functional vibration resistance: 10 to 55 Hz (at double amplitude of 3.3 mm .130 inch)
Destructive vibration resistance: 10 to 55 Hz (at double amplitude of 5 mm .197 inch)

In tube packaging, which ensures safe handling and transportation.
Key details include:
· Orientation Mark: The relay is packed in a tube with an orientation mark on the left side, ensuring correct placement during PCB assembly.
· Protection: Tube packing prevents damage to the relay’s pins and casing during shipping.
· Ease of Use: The tube format is compatible with automated pick-and-place machines, making it ideal for high-volume manufacturing.
